Description
Role Main Purpose: The CSR Manager will lead the development and execution of the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) strategy, aligning with Vision 2030, national priorities, and SPL’s mission to positively impact Saudi society through football. This role is responsible for integrating purpose-driven initiatives across the League and Clubs, fostering community engagement, enhancing reputation, and driving measurable social impact. Operational Responsibilities: Strategic Development & Leadership Design, implement, and oversee the SPL-wide CSR strategy, embedding sustainability and community impact at the core of the League's activities. Align CSR programs with national initiatives (e.g. التشجير, جمعية إنسان, جمعية زهرة), United Nations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s), and Vision 2030. Champion SPL’s social responsibility internally and externally, ensuring consistent messaging, visibility, and impact. Program Management Lead planning and execution of key CSR campaigns, including those related to youth, health, disability inclusion, environmental sustainability, and national celebrations. Manage partnerships with charitable organizations, government agencies, and NGOs. Ensure efficient governance, monitoring, and evaluation systems for all CSR activities. Develop League-wide toolkits and guidelines for Clubs to activate CSR programs locally and consistently. Stakeholder Engagement Act as the primary liaison with key stakeholders including the Ministry of Sports, national NGOs, sponsors, and the wider SPL ecosystem. Secure buy-in from internal departments (Marketing, Commercial, PR, Operations) to embed CSR in campaigns, activations, and matchdays. Identify opportunities for strategic partnerships and funding that enhance SPL’s CSR profile. Reporting & Communications Develop periodic CSR reports highlighting achievements, impact metrics, case studies, and alignment with national goals. Coordinate with the Corporate Communications team to ensure proper storytelling across platforms. Represent SPL at relevant CSR events, forums, and panels locally and internationally. Strategic & Leadership Responsibilities: Develop and oversee the CSR strategy for the SPL, focusing on sustainability and community engagement. Ensure CSR initiatives align with national priorities, including Vision 2030 and the United Nations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s). Promote SPL’s commitment to social responsibility, enhancing visibility and impact both internally and externally. Key Performance Indicators: Successfully implement the CSR strategy aligned with Saudi Vision 2030. Increase community participation in local CSR programs. Receive positive feedback from stakeholders, including government and NGOs. Establish strategic partnerships within Saudi Arabia. Produce quality CSR reports that highlight contributions to national goals. Achieve positive media coverage in local and regional outlets. Main Contacts: Employees Business Partners Media Outlets Local Communities Education & Experience: Bachelor’s degree in CSR, Sustainability, Public Policy, Communications, or related field (master’s preferred). 8+ years of experience in CSR, sustainability, or public affairs, ideally in a corporate or sports environment. Knowledge & Skills: Deep understanding of the Saudi nonprofit and CSR ecosystem. Proven track record of delivering measurable social impact programs. Strong project management, stakeholder engagement, and strategic thinking capabilities. Arabic and English fluency (spoken and written) required.
